Output d7db6a107352a50cfcade8faf41d424f789b3892827f95cadafd70ad19cf173e:1

value
10926317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a130b959034a883038701cb7e266c92c46eb1b OP_EQUAL
address
3KFYm5LNVPeYnhK9jjAPqhxqCgTdjvmkPA
transaction
d7db6a107352a50cfcade8faf41d424f789b3892827f95cadafd70ad19cf173e
confirmations
280520
spent
true